Introduction: The Growing Concerns Over Data Centers
As the demand for cloud computing and digital services skyrockets, major tech companies are rapidly expanding their data center infrastructure. Recently, Amazon announced plans for a massive data center in Texas that has generated significant debate. Critics argue that this facility could potentially become the largest single source of climate pollution in the United States. This article explores the implications of such an investment and why it matters now more than ever.
The Details Behind Amazon's Investment
Amazon's new facility is designed to support its vast network of services, but it will also be powered by an on-site power plant. This approach raises questions about sustainability. Data centers typically require immense amounts of energy, and depending on the energy sources used, these facilities can lead to substantial greenhouse gas emissions. Some estimates suggest that if built as planned, Amazon's Texas center could emit millions of tons of CO2 annually.
Understanding the Environmental Impact
The core of the concern lies in the choice of energy sources. If the power plant relies on fossil fuels, the environmental repercussions could be dire. In contrast, renewable energy can mitigate some of this impact, yet critics argue that simply building more data centers without a comprehensive strategy for sustainable energy use is counterproductive.
